A theme park has a log that can hold 12 people. They also have a weight limit of 1500 lbs per log for safety reason. If the average adult weighs 150 lbs, the average child weighs 100 lbs and the log itself weights 200, the ride can operate safely if the inequality
150A+100C+200<1500

<=less or equal

Is satisfied (A is the number of adults and C is the number of children in the log ride together). THere are several groups of children of differing numbers waiting to ride. Groups one has 4 children, group two has 3 children, group three has 9 children, group four 6 children while group five has 5 children.
If 4 adults are already seated in the log, which groups of children can safely ride with them? Explain please~



Answer :

If 4 adults are already in the log, then 150*4 = 600
600 + 100C + 200 = 1500
Re-arranged, 100C = 1500 - 600 - 200
Or simply
100C = 700
Divide each side by 100 to isolate C
So C = 7
So a maximum of 7 children can be seated in the log
All the groups except group 3 can be in the log
